The 46th Four Hills Tournament 1997/98 was part of the Ski Jumping World Cup 1997/1998 . The jumping in Oberstdorf took place on December 29th, the jumping in Garmisch-Partenkirchen on January 1st and the jumping in Innsbruck on January 4th . The event in Bischofshofen finally took place on January 6th.

Total status
| Item | Jumper | country | Points |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Kazuyoshi Funaki |
|
944.0 |
| 2 | Sven Hannawald |
|
912.8 |
| 3 | Janne Ahonen |
|
907.0 |
| 4th | Andreas Goldberger |
|
884.4 |
| 5 | Jani Soininen |
|
863.7 |
| 6th | Dieter Thoma |
|
859.1 |
| 7th | Andreas Widhölzl |
|
831.8 |
| 8th | Stefan Horngacher |
|
808.8 |
| 9 | Kazuya Yoshioka |
|
804.3 |
| 10 | Masahiko Harada |
|
777.9 |
